Promoting Open Government
Here is something everyone can do to promote open government. Go to your town or city hall and find out if the clerk has posted a brief statement about your right to obtain a public record. The Massachusetts Public Records Law states, “The clerk of every city or town shall post, in a conspicuous place in the city or town hall in the vicinity of the clerk’s office, a brief printed statement that any citizen may, at his discretion, obtain copies of certain public records from local officials for a fee as provided for in this chapter.” M.G.L. c. 66,
